Diffuser.fm Radio, our killer online radio station, has some new music this week, and whether you like bearded singer-songwriters, synth-wrangling arena rockers or female folktronica heroines, you're in luck. Just-added tunes include genre-blurring Austin bluesman Gary Clark Jr.'s 'Ain't Messin' Around' and indie hero Father John Misty's 'Nancy From Now On,' as well as two songs from bands with serious Springsteen fixations: the Gaslight Anthem's 'Here Comes My Man' and the Killers' 'Miss Atomic Bomb.' Last but not least is Beth Orton's lovely 'Magpie' -- proof that we're into more than just dudes with guitars.
